WebThe quickest way to renew road tax is online, but you can also renew at a Post Office. Renewing online, you will need the following: Your vehicle registration document (V5C), new keeper's slip or V11 reminder. Valid MOT certificate if the vehicle is over three years old. Valid insurance certificate or cover note. Web1 de dez. de 2024 · Deducting car registration taxes. Annual car registration fees may be deductible on your federal income taxes, but only under certain circumstances. The portion of the registration fee that is charged based on the vehicle's value - as opposed to its size, age or other characteristics - can generally be claimed as a deduction.
